Khartoum’s Ruins: A Reporter Reflects on Loss and Hope Amid Sudan’s War

In a poignant report, a Sky reporter returns to their childhood home in war-torn Khartoum, Sudan, where destruction and looting have left the city in ruins. Following the 2023 power struggle between Sudan’s Armed Forces (SAF) and the paramilitary Rapid Support Forces (RSF), the capital was left in devastation, with at least 61,000 people killed and millions displaced. The army has now reclaimed the city after two years of occupation. The journalist, who returned home following the army’s victory, reports that once-vibrant streets are now lined with bullet-ridden buildings and charred homes. While their family home remains standing, it’s been ransacked, with furniture, appliances, and personal items stolen. Yet, among the destruction, the reporter finds small reminders of hope—a family photo album, a rocking chair, and a painting, symbolizing the resilience of the Sudanese spirit amidst overwhelming loss.
